Full Moon April 2023: The Pink Full Moon

Mark your calendars for the next April 2023 Full Moon. The next April full moon is Thursday April 6, 2023 12:34 AM EDT or 4:34 AM UTC based on the data provided by NASA. It will be the fourth full moon in 2023.

A full moon occurs when the Earth is directly between the Sun and Moon so that the moon looks completely illuminated when you look at it. It happens about once a month or, 29.53 days on average.

What is the name of the April 2023 Full Moon?

The April full moon is commonly referred to as the Pink Moon. The name comes from a pink herb moss that would flower that was widespread at that time of year.

As with the moons in other months, there are additional nicknames for April’s full moon. They include:

  • Egg Moon,
  • Full Sprouting Grass Moon,
  • Full Fish Moon (generally among the coastal indigenous tribes)

They all have a common tie to the spring season as new flowers start to bloom and the fish begin to spawn.

Which season includes the April Full Moon?

In 2023, the April Full Moon will be the first full moon of the Spring 2023 season. It will be the first full moon after the Vernal Equinox in 2023.

The Vernal or Spring equinox marks the beginning of astronomical spring and the end of astronomical winter in the Northern Hemisphere.

In 2023, the Vernal Equinox will be Monday March 20, 2023 5:25 PM EDT or 9:25 PM UTC.

Will there be a full supermoon in April 2023?

No, the full moon in April 2023 will not be a full supermoon as it will be more than 360,000 kilometers away during the peak of the full moon. The year will have 2 supermoons in August and 2 additional full supermoons depending on the definition you use.

A full supermoon is a full moon that nearly coincides with the closest point that the Moon comes to the Earth in its orbit, called perigee. The moon has a larger-than-usual appearance when you look at it. There isn’t an official definition for how close the moon must be to the Earth to be considered a supermoon. Depending on the version you use, the moon needs to be approximately 360,000 kilometers from the Earth or closer.

Will there be a lunar eclipse during the April Full Moon?

No there will not be a lunar eclipse during the full moon in April 2023. In the future, there will be an eclipse during the first full moon of the year.

In 2023 there will be two lunar eclipses during the year. The May Full Moon will have a penumbral lunar eclipse and there will be a partial lunar eclipse during the October Full Moon.

April 2023 Moon Phases in Eastern Time and UTC

Below are the lunar phases for April 2023 including the new moon, first quarter, full moon, and last quarter that are on the schedule for each month. The date and times are based on both the United States Eastern Time Zone and UTC, adjusted for daylight saving time.

Lunar PhaseEastern Date & Time (US)UTC Date & Time
April Full MoonApril 6, 2023 12:34 AM EDTApril 6, 2023 4:34 AM UTC
April Last QuarterApril 13, 2023 5:11 AM EDTApril 13, 2023 9:11 AM UTC
April New MoonApril 20, 2023 12:12 AM EDTApril 20, 2023 4:12 AM UTC
April First QuarterApril 27, 2023 5:20 PM EDTApril 27, 2023 9:20 PM UTC
